About the School

  • First Baptist Child Development Center serves 132 students in grades Prekindergarten-Kindergarten, is a member of the Other religious school association(s), the Other special emphasis association(s) and the Other school association(s).
  • First Baptist Child Development Center religious affiliation is Baptist.
